On August 3rd 1991 Ronan Leonard was on a ship called the Oceanos that set out from East London, South Africa headed for Durban. The ship ran into 40 knot winds and 9 metre (30 foot) swells. While off the coast an explosion was heard and the ship lost power and started to take on water. The Captain and crew left passengers onboard while they sailed to safety. The Oceanos later sunk. Ronan was one of the last people onboard.

Ronan also unpacks masterminds, a concept that has its genesis in Napoleon Hill's 1937 classic book, Think and Grow Rich. A mastermind group is designed to help people overcome challenges with help from the collective expertise and skill-sets of others. A group might meet monthly, weekly, or even daily to receive support, provide advice, share resources, and tackle problems together. According to Ronan, successful mastermind meetings always have some sort of an agenda and someone in moderator role, ensuring conversations stay on track. Other points of discussion include: the optimum number of participants for a successful mastermindhow long masterminds should run forhow much successful mastermind facilitators are chargingthe difference between group coaching and mastermind groups A key takeaway from Ronan is that subject matter experts should teach to the problem: "You want to teach what people want to learn, not what you want to teach," he says. Masterminds with Ronan Leonard Use Masterminds to Improve your Productivity and Accountability Although Ronan lives in Australia, he was born in Hitchin in Hertfordshire, England. He still supports England when playing Test Cricket in Australia, but you couldn't put a fag paper between his accent and that of a naturalised Aussie. What are Masterminds? The most popular definition comes from Napoleon Hill's book Think and Grow Rich. Hill said 'when two or minds come together they create this third super mind.' This mastermind is always better than the collective thoughts of two people. Ronan told us that the Impressionist Movement came about through masterminds. They would sit and discuss painting in Parisian coffee shops. They collectively forged a new way forward for artistic painting. A Programme for Masterminds Ronan has developed a programme for to help small business owners get involved. Check out his website - click on the image. He connects small business owners into a mastermind. There they hep each other with advice and goal setting. Effectively the masterminds are crowd-sourcing everybody's intellectual property and experience. So rather than saying this is what you must do, everybody has an opinion. If you were struggling with internet marketing and SEO, you could pick and choose from the experience and insights of others in a supportive environment. No one-guru on the the hill. Now this isn't a masterminds business that isn't 100% rooted in our guests own backstory, as back in 2003 he had sunk his life savings going into business when he had no idea what he was doing. He spent a year learning marketing, networking etc- all as a side hustle because he worked full time. After 12 months I'd made just 1 $600.00 sale, had spent $30K and was close to giving up. Then he found a mentor and within two weeks made an online sale for $1,300 and his business was up and running. The life lesson he learned. You don't know what you don't know. But certainly someone else does, and the more people you connect with the greater the chance to find that solution to your problem.
